1. Product Introduction
Alpha-Ketoglutaric Acid (AKG), chemically known as α-ketoglutarate, is a naturally occurring organic acid that plays a vital role in metabolic processes within living organisms. It is a key intermediate in the tricarboxylic acid (TCA) cycle and is essential for amino acid synthesis, nitrogen metabolism, and energy production. AKG is widely used in dietary supplements, sports nutrition, and medical applications, earning it the reputation of a "versatile metabolic agent."

2. Production Process
Recent advancements have significantly improved the production process of AKG, with key developments including:
1. Microbial Fermentation
• Process: Genetically modified microorganisms (e.g., E. coli or yeast) are used to efficiently convert glucose or other carbon sources into AKG.
• Advantages: Environmentally friendly, cost-effective, and suitable for large-scale production.
• Latest Progress: Optimized strains and fermentation conditions have significantly increased yield and purity.
2. Chemical Synthesis
• Process: AKG is synthesized through chemical oxidation using citric acid or cis-aconitic acid as raw materials.
• Advantages: Mature technology, suitable for high-purity AKG production.
• Latest Progress: Green chemistry practices have reduced the use of harmful solvents, enhancing sustainability.
3. Enzymatic Synthesis
• Process: Specific enzymes (e.g., ketoglutarate dehydrogenase) catalyze the conversion of substrates into AKG.
• Advantages: Mild reaction conditions, high selectivity, and fewer by-products.
• Latest Progress: Immobilized enzyme technology has improved enzyme stability and reusability.
4.Purification Techniques
• Process: Crystallization and chromatography (e.g., high-performance liquid chromatography) are used to purify AKG.
• Advantages: Enables pharmaceutical-grade high-purity AKG.
• Latest Progress: Continuous purification technology has improved efficiency and yield.

3.Latest Research Applications
Recent advancements have significantly improved the production process of AKG, with key developments including:
1. Anti-Aging and Longevity
• Research: AKG activates the AMPK pathway and inhibits the mTOR pathway, delaying cellular aging and extending lifespan in model organisms.
• Applications: As an anti-aging supplement to address age-related diseases (e.g., osteoporosis, muscle atrophy).
2. Sports Nutrition and Recovery
• Research: AKG reduces post-exercise lactic acid buildup, promotes muscle protein synthesis, and accelerates recovery.
• Applications: As a sports nutrition supplement to enhance performance and recovery efficiency.
3. Immune Regulation
• Research: AKG modulates the mTOR signaling pathway, enhancing immune cell function and improving infection resistance.
• Applications: In immune support products to boost immune function.
4.Metabolic Health
• Research: AKG improves metabolic status in chronic kidney disease patients and reduces ammonia toxicity.
• Applications: As a metabolic health supplement to support kidney and liver function.
5.Gut Health
• Research: AKG serves as a key energy source for intestinal cells, promoting mucosal repair.
• Applications: In gut health products to improve intestinal barrier function.
